If there's one thing thriving during the pandemic, it's cybercrime. The work-from-home trend has created an appetizing target for hackers, as employees have often accessed secure company networks from devices that may not be fitted with the same protection as those in the office. 

In the first half of 2021, a total of 1,097 organizations were hit with ransomware attacks worldwide, with cybercriminals seizing networks and critical data with the goal of extracting payment from their victims. By comparison, 1,112 organizations were hit by these attacks in the whole of 2020.
